Over 276,000 Tech Jobs Displaced by AI in 2024-2025, New Research Reveals A recent study by Careery has identified that more than 276,000 tech workers have lost their jobs due to AI-driven layoffs between 2024 and 2025. The research highlights 15 high-risk job categories within the tech industry and provides actionable strategies to mitigate the impact of AI-driven job displacement.
